Himalayas logo
NC

iOS Developer (6+ Years Experience)

NXTKEY CORPORATION
United States only

Stay safe on Himalayas

Never send money to companies. Jobs on Himalayas will never require payment from applicants.

We are seeking an experienced iOS Developer with a strong command of Swift, SwiftUI, and TCA, who can architect and deliver high-quality mobile applications in an Agile environment. The ideal candidate will also demonstrate proficiency in using AI-powered tools to enhance productivity, accelerate development, and optimize project workflows.

Key Responsibilities

  • Design, develop, and maintain iOS applications using Swift, SwiftUI, and The Composable Architecture (TCA).
  • Integrate Apple APIs including Apple Maps, APNS, and Apple Wallet.
  • Implement unit and UI tests compatible with automated testing frameworks like Appium.
  • Collaborate within Agile (LeSS) project environments to ensure alignment with sprint goals and deliverables.
  • Utilize AI tools (ChatGPT, Copilot, Gemini, etc.) for code generation, idea generation, and data analysis to boost development efficiency.
  • Support CI/CD build pipelines (GitLab CI preferred), and maintain platform-specific build configurations.
  • Work with cross-functional teams to integrate unified data and business logic layers, ensuring scalable and maintainable codebases.
  • Minimum 6 years of hands-on iOS development experience.
  • Expert-level knowledge in Swift, SwiftUI, and TCA.
  • Strong understanding of Agile methodologies, ideally in LeSS environments.
  • Experience with AI-assisted coding tools and familiarity with AI agents for code generation.
  • Proven ability to set up and manage GitLab CI/CD pipelines.
  • Knowledge of multiplatform frameworks (Ktor, Room/SQL Delight, SKIE) is a plus.
  • Experience in automated testing and mobile app deployment best practices.

Preferred Qualifications

  • Exposure to Kotlin Multiplatform or Jetpack Compose.
  • Strong debugging, problem-solving, and code optimization skills.
  • Familiarity with Firebase, Google Wallet, or cross-platform integrations (advantageous).

NXTKey Corporation has been delivering Information Technology, Information management, Information Assurance (IA) and cybersecurity solutions to US Federal Government and Commercial Clients since 2005.

About the job

Apply before

Posted on

Job type

Full Time

Experience level

Senior

Location requirements

Hiring timezones

United States +/- 0 hours

About NXTKEY CORPORATION

Learn more about NXTKEY CORPORATION and their company culture.

View company profile
Claim this profileNC

NXTKEY CORPORATION

View company profile

Similar remote jobs

Here are other jobs you might want to apply for.

View all remote jobs

5 remote jobs at NXTKEY CORPORATION

Explore the variety of open remote roles at NXTKEY CORPORATION, offering flexible work options across multiple disciplines and skill levels.

View all jobs at NXTKEY CORPORATION

Remote companies like NXTKEY CORPORATION

Find your next opportunity by exploring profiles of companies that are similar to NXTKEY CORPORATION. Compare culture, benefits, and job openings on Himalayas.

View all companies

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an